Still Breitling watch brought to jeweler for repair. after a few weeks message, watch was 'fixed'. €150 paid. after a day it stopped again. brought to jeweler again. this process has now repeated itself 4 times. in total 9 months at jeweler. watch is still not working. ask jeweler 'what are we going to do about this now, it is clear that you cannot repair this'. response: 'i have spent hours on it, I can send it to Breitling, then €150 will be deducted from the costs'. i do not want that. other option from jeweler: 'buy another watch here minus the €150'. i do not want that either. my question: what am i entitled to now?

Lawyer

Is a lenient proposal if the jeweler has only charged once. If he has done so multiple times, you could argue that the professional should understand before you that knowledge or skill is lacking, the 2nd or 3rd time for repair. Then a breach of contract has occurred.
